It's Mid Week!!! The Daily Challenge Continues



Its the middle of the week! We are halfway there! I hope you did your work the last two days. If you are just joining us TODAY, welcome!!! Go check out Monday's post, then Tuesdays and then come back to here. I have them listed Monday through Friday but any FIVE days in a row will work!

SO far I've had you: Identify a cluttered space, figure out why it's cluttered, look for all the things that don't belong in that space and think about how it got there. Hopefully with those four things, you have a nice picture in your head of what is going on.

Today's challenge is:

Get a box or basket or bag(s). Take everything that DOESN'T belong in that space and put it in the box/basket/bag. Toss it in there. Doesn't matter where it goes. We will get to that. Get that space cleared of all things that don't belong there.



When you are done, take a look at that space. Is the counter top a counter top again? Can u see your bed? Now the couch is ready for guests. Look at how nice the space is. OR it may be dirty or dusty depending on how long its been that way. I invite you to vaccum/wipe/dust off that space.  take a look at it again. See how nice it looks!

Then put the bag/box/basket back on top of the space. Leave it there overnight.

Monday, February 2, 2015

A New Week, A New Challange!




Happy Monday Everyone!

Its a new month! I am feeling energized. I have a productive weekend. Like last week, I am going to give you guys a daily challenge THIS week.

Today's challenge is:

Identify the spot in your home that seems to have the most stuff in it.

Take your time if you need to. Identify the spot in your home that seems to collect the most stuff. It could be a sofa/couch. Maybe its the kitchen counter top. Could it be your bed? What area seems to NEVER have space/room?

ONCE you've identified the spot (there might be several spots, but for now lets just focus on ONE) think about why THAT particular spot is like that?! Maybe you can write it down or keep it mentally in your head. Thank about WHY that spot is always cluttered?

Thats all for today. Just find the spot and think about why its the way it is!

Fall Down, Get Up

Learning is hard.

Think about it, babies all learn the same way, trial and error. They try, fail, and try again until it becomes second nature. When they get to being toddlers and try walking, they fall and literally get back up. All of this can be applied to life as an adult and taking risks in love career, home or art. 
Babies don’t get the luxury of learning via audiobook, DVD, webinar, or classroom. What they do is watch others and try it themselves. And remember everybody learns differently. There are many techniques out there for ways to learn and retain information. Go at YOUR own pace. 
Stay open to learning and don't be afraid to fall. You can always get back up!
